Some community details (provided by our in-country partners)

On 17th of March 2015, a workshop was held for 21 participants chosen from this large community of 1500 people. This town is a newly established community along the Monrovia Kakata highway at the place that was occupied by the Mount Barclay Rubber plantation. The people of Jlazohn are faced with a serious challenge as it relates to save drinking water. There two hand dug wells that are providing water for the people in this community produces water that appears to be milky, some residences in this town has developed a system to filtrate the water before use for cooking and drinking. Most people in this town are engage with other economic activities in town, they have to awake early in the morning to get water for their homes in order to be on time. The women and children are the ones mainly involved with fetching water for their homes, the expression of joy can be seen in their faces as the new pump was being dedicated. The people of Jlazohn are grateful to Lifewater and the sponsors for providing them this pump which has given them a safe and good water source.

Well Details

Project Completed: 2015-04-25 Well Depth: 50 ft.
Depth of Water: 5.00 ft. Casing Diameter: 4.00 in.
Screen Length: 10.00 ft. Developed By: Electric Pump
Development Time: 1.50 hrs. Well Yield: 10.00 gpm
Disinfection: 24.00 hrs. Handpump: Afridev
Water Colour: Clear Water Odour: None
Turbidity: Clear Taste:
Nitrate: 0.000 mg/L Bacti Test: Negative
Iron: 0.000 mg/L pH: 7.000
